Ticket #— Floor 9 Opening Prep, Brindlemoor House

Hi facilities folks, Floor 9 opens to staff next Monday and we need a few things squared away before then. Lift access is live, but the two side doors by the kitchenette are still on the old lock config — please reprogram them before Friday. Also, signage for the quiet rooms hasn't arrived, so pop up the temporary printed ones for now. Until the badge readers sync, the interim door code for Floor 9 is below.

door code, bajop-bajog: bdg-DSWAC-43621

## Deploying the Gatewick Proctor Queue

Deploys are pretty painless: push to main, wait for the pipeline, then watch the queue drain dashboard for five minutes. If candidates pile up mid-exam, roll back first and ask questions later — the queue replays safely. Everything the workers care about lives in one config block, shown here for reference.

settings of bafof-yagef:
JOROX_PIN=8740
JOROX_TENANT=pelox
JOROX_METRICS_HOST=metrics.jorox.qorvelworks.internal
JOROX_SEAL=seal_c78f63c1
JOROX_STANDBY_TEAM=norax

# Break-Glass: Catalog Cache Invalidation

Scope: the Pinrow product catalog at Veldstone Retail. If stale prices persist after a purge and the Hollowmere invalidation queue is wedged, use break-glass to flush the edge tier directly. Contractors: get verbal sign-off from the catalog lead first. Steps: open the Hollowmere admin shell, select emergency-flush, confirm the tenant, and run it once — repeated flushes thrash the origin. Access is logged and expires after 20 minutes. Unseal the admin shell with the passphrase below.

recovery phrase for kahop-tajog: istix-casvan

## Nightly reindex (Searchloft)

Every night at 02:10 the Searchloft reindexer rebuilds the product index from the Cartwheel catalog. If customers report stale search results after 06:00, the job likely stalled — check `reindex.log` for a `checkpoint_lag` warning before escalating. You can safely rerun the job manually with `loft reindex --resume`; it is idempotent and resumes from the last checkpoint. The rerun requires the indexing credential to be present in `.env.reindex`, so add it on the line directly below this one.

vault entry, kafog-yahop: COURIER_KEY8=0faa53ae